Meet Francisco Corona of WU Fighters World in SouthWest

Today we’d like to introduce you to Francisco Corona.

Francisco, can you briefly walk us through your story – how you started and how you got to where you are today.
I was a full time student a couple of years back at UH Main Campus, I was majoring in Kinesiology Sport Management; however, I had to drop out in order to dedicate my full time and energy to work and save money to open my business. In order to make ends meet, I’ve been bartending and managing different restaurants/night clubs. In actuality, this is how I started saving money to start the business of WU Fighters World. Since I can remember I have always been involved in martial arts; I have been practicing and competing in martial arts all my life since I was 4 years old, so this is truly my passion. Several years back I decided to take the risk in opening a store to somehow be in the game, it has always been my dream, so why not start something that I love. Like many businesses I started very small; 2 or 3 boxes of gear arranged neatly in the trunk of my car and going from gym to gym offering the gear. After which the business moved from the trunk of the car to a small 8×5 self-storage unit….I was moving up in the entrepreneurial world. The location was not easy to find; therefore, I had to continue my door to door knocking in order to sell. I must have moved two or three more times, each time making it more accessible to the client until we found the perfect little nook in the Galleria area that has housed WU Fighters World for the past 3 years.

Great, so let’s dig a little deeper into the story – has it been an easy path overall and if not, what were the challenges you’ve had to overcome?
I think it’s never a smooth road for small and new business owners to start their own business, or at least it wasn’t me. This is a very niche market with many competitors, most of which are online stores.

To be quite honest, there’s been couple of times that I almost shut down the doors because I had no sales or not enough sales to even pay the rent. I think, just like in life, we learn from our mistakes, roll with the punches and simply keep moving forward.

WU Fighters World – what should we know? What do you guys do best? What sets you apart from the competition?
Wu Fighter’s World is a mixed martial arts supply store. It’s a place for those that train in all kinds of Martial Arts and MMA. You can get all kinds of gear and accessories from boxing gloves to MMA shorts, Muay Thai shorts, Gis, Karate gear, mouth guards and everything you need to train. If you are more of a fan we also have some cool stuff for you. We produce our own brand WU Pro Fighting Gear for the everyday enthusiast; we carry top brands like Cleto Reyes, Venum, Ringside, BadBoy, Everlast, Damage Control, Revgear, Zepol and way more cool stuff.

In my humble opinion, I think what sets us apart from our competitors is that fact that we can relate to the up and coming fighters, those who have nothing but a dream. Being brought up in the Mixed Martial Art world, I know how hard it is for some fighters to get gear or pay for their medicals before a fight;  therefore, I am very proud to be able to provide support and sponsorship to fighters in the community.

Ultimately, my main goal is to provide a local place for the Martial Art community to be able to stop by for anything they need. Sometimes people stop by to simply chat about last week’s UFC fight or boxing fight, and I love and welcome that. Houston is a main hub for many things and MMA, Muay Thai, and Boxing is definitely one of those things that are growing exponentially. More and more fighters are emerging as well as events all over the city and we want to be here to support them and be a part of their lives.
